What I Look For Before Buying

Before I buy any tire glue, I always check a few important things:

  • Bond strength: I want a glue that creates a strong and lasting hold.
  • Drying time: I prefer a product that cures fast enough without rushing the job.
  • Weather resistance: My tire repairs need to handle heat, moisture, and road conditions.
  • Ease of use: I like glue that applies smoothly and does not make a mess.
  • Compatibility: I make sure it works with the type of tire or patch I’m using.

Types of Tire Glue I Usually Consider

I’ve found that tire glue comes in different forms, and each one has its own purpose:

  • Rubber cement: I use this for patching and basic tire repair work.
  • Super glue style adhesives: These can work for small fixes, but I’m careful because they are not always ideal for tires.
  • Specialty tire adhesives: These are often my preferred choice because they are made specifically for tire-related repairs.

My Experience With Performance

In my experience, the best tire glue is the one that stays reliable after repeated use. I pay attention to whether the adhesive holds under pressure, heat, and vibration. If a product starts peeling or losing grip too soon, I know it is not worth buying again.

Safety and Application Tips I Follow

Whenever I use tire glue, I make sure to:

  • Clean the surface thoroughly before applying it
  • Follow the instructions on the label
  • Use the right amount of glue, not too much
  • Allow enough curing time before putting the tire back into use
  • Work in a well-ventilated area
